The transaction identifier and the signed message are hashed under different domain tags on purpose, so a signature over one can never be mistaken for a signature over the other.
The signature layer currently compiled into the core is a deliberate stub. Signatures are trivially forgeable. Do not put value on any Astrolune network yet.
